Nicknamed "Dragon Ships" by the North Vietnamese, older C-47s played a vital role during the Vietnam war as AC-47 gun-ships. The twin engined C-47s were slow, roomy aircraft that provided platforms for the mounting of three General Electric 6-barrelled "miniguns" each capable of firing 6,000 round per minute. With night time interdiction missions their forte, "Spookys" carried out devastating V. C. attacks and became the American close support terror from the skies. This kit represents a "reissue" of the original 1960s blue box release that came out in the the early 1990s. This PUFF The Magic Dragon model which is once again out-of-production includes the following features: 1) Authentic markings for a "Spooky" gunship operated by the United States Air Force during the Vietnam War; 2) Clear plastic glass areas; 3) Landing gear that can be mounted in either the open or closed position; 4) Propellers and main wheels that rotate; 5) Molded in "Jungle Green"; 6) Sculptured pilot and co-pilot-gunner; 7) Three detailed General Electric "Mini-guns" and 8) Illustrated assembly instructions.
